Heritage foods Limited has achieved a significant milestone in cybersecurity by receiving the ISO 27001:2022 Certification for its Information Security Management System (ISMS) from ISOQAR Limited. The certification announcement was made on April 30, 2026, through a regulatory filing under Regulation 30 of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015.
Certification Details and Framework Implementation
The ISO 27001:2022 certification recognizes Heritage Foods Limited's commitment to implementing internationally recognized standards for information security management. The company has systematically adopted the ISO 27001:2022 framework to identify, assess, and manage information security risks in a structured and effective manner.
| Certification Aspect: | Details |
|---|---|
| Certification Body: | ISOQAR Limited |
| Standard: | ISO 27001:2022 |
| Focus Area: | Information Security Management System (ISMS) |
| Date of Announcement: | April 30, 2026 |

Regulatory Compliance and Documentation
The certification announcement was formally communicated to both BSE Limited and National Stock Exchange of India Limited as part of regulatory disclosure requirements. Heritage Foods Limited, incorporated under CIN L15209TG1992PLC014332, maintains its registered office in Hyderabad, Telangana, and continues to operate as an ISO 22000 certified company alongside this new information security certification.
